Just Add Water teases Oddworld: Hand of Odd

Developer Just Add Water is trading Oddworld HD remakes for the real deal. This week, the studio activated a website for a new Oddworld chapter called Hand of God which, as the source code explains, is a brand new project between Just Add Water and its friends at Oddworld Inhabitants.

“To clarify the #HandofOdd talk, we won't be talking about this project yet, however I CAN say, it will NOT be like 'FarmVille' as some say,” tweeted Just Add Water, later adding, “Oh and DEFINITELY NOT a Facebook game : -/”

Gauging by the confused smiley, it appears some are expecting a browser based Oddworld chapter. It's good to see Just Add Water shoot down the idea, but we'll rest easier when it announces a specific console and/or PC release.

Just Add Water is responsible for last year's Oddworld: Stranger's Wrath HD remake on PSN, and the forthcoming Oddworld: Abe's Oddysee HD. Back in February, the studio inked a licensing deal with game engine and tech developer Bitsquid for the sole purpose of paving the way for “future Oddworld games”.
